Audra McDonald Heads To 'The Good Wife' And More Casting News

Audra McDonald Books A Role On 'The Good Wife'

From "Private Practice" to "The Good Wife" ...

According to The Hollywood Reporter, "Private Practice" alum Audra McDonald has booked a guest role on "The Good Wife" as Alicia's (Julianna Margulies) enemy from their Georgetown Law School days.

McDonald is only slated for one episode at the moment, but will possibly have an arc.

Other Season 4 "Good Wife" guest stars include Matthew Perry, Kristin Chenoweth, Maura Tierney and Michael J. Fox.

In other casting news...

Deborah Shelton and Cathy Podewell are headed back to "Dallas." J.R.'s mistresses are on their way back to Southfork for one last J.R.-related hurrah. Known for playing Mandy Winger and Cally Harper, the actresses will reprise their roles to say a few words at J.R. Ewing's (Larry Hagman) funeral. [TV Guide]

"True Detective" has nabbed some new cast members. Alexandra Daddario, Elizabeth Reaser, Wood Harris and Michael Potts have all landed roles in HBO's new series. [Deadline]

Mark Moses is "Blue Bloods"-bound. The "Mad Men" alum has been cast on the CBS series as Curtis Swint, a "racist, xenophobic talk-radio host," who broadcasts his show live in New York. [TV Guide]
